Results are in for Calum Ferguson. His ancestor is Uilleam
ClannFhearghuis (William Ferguson) b.~1796 son of Pàdruig (Peter) on
the Isle of Lewis in the Hebrides. Calum matches close enough to Neil
Ferguson and the late David Lawrence Ferguson to define a new clade,
i.e. Haplogroup R1b - Clade: Hebrides. Neils ancestors are from St.
Kilda and David's the Isle of Islay, they are compared on this page
http://dna.cfsna.net/HAP/R1b/Hebrides.htm
Also a member of the Hebrides clade is Rodney Ferguson whose ancestor
is from Clones, county Monaghan in Northern Ireland. Presumably
Rodney's ancestors emigrated to Ulster but in truth we are stuck with
the chicken and egg question "which came first the Irish Ferguson or
the Scottish Ferguson?"
